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is titled "Distributed package management using meta-scheduling." This innovative system includes an interface and a processor designed to streamline package management. The interface receives an indication to install a package, while the processor determines a configured package using a set of local configuration properties. It then launches a set of subschedulers through a metascheduler to install multiple applications of the configured package.
